About Makoto Sakai

Makoto Sakai is a partner at Mori Hamada & Matsumoto, and works primarily in the practice areas of wealth management, tax and M&A. In relation to wealth management, he has handled many cases involving domestic and cross-border business succession planning, as well as inheritance planning and tax disputes. Making the most of his experience as a former Review Officer at the Tokyo Regional Taxation Bureau, he takes a pragmatic approach when examining matters from a tax perspective. Makoto has authored and co-authored many books, including “Legal and Tax Affairs in Business Successions and M&A for Family Businesses”.
